Each workorder contains details about the repair work performed, including:
- Number of repaired panels
- Type and quantity of paint products used
- Car information
- Work provider details
The Single Workorder Report provides a bodyshop summary or detailed view of a selected workorder. It can be used for insurance claims or can be attached to a customer job report.
Running the Report
To generate the report, follow these steps:
- Navigate to Reports → Single Workorder.
- Select the specific workorder number from the dropdown list on the right.
- If needed, filter workorders using the search field next to the magnifying glass icon.
Filtering Workorders
Use the following examples to filter workorders:
- Workorders ending in 2020: Remove the asterisk (*) and enter
%2020
to filter workorders that end with "2020". - Workorders starting with "ABC": Enter
ABC
or*ABC
to filter workorders that start with "ABC". (Example: "ABC123" will be found, but "MyABC" will not.) - Workorders containing "ABC": Enter
%ABC%
to filter all workorders that contain "ABC". (Example: "MyABC" will be found.)
Viewing the Report
After selecting the correct workorder, click the "View Report" button to generate the report.
The report includes:
- Repair details
- Vehicle information
- Status updates
- List of all mixes used in the workorder
Note: Only the percentage of mix associated with the selected workorder is shown in the report.
Toggle Between Views
- Click "- Hide mix components" to see a summary view.
- Click "+ Show mix components" to return to the detailed view.
Paint Material Percentage Update Delay
The Paint Material Percentage field in the Workorder Report may take 30-45 minutes to update. The value for Paint Material Percentage can be changed from Settings → General.
